        Why do people state falsehoods with such certainty? The damages that can awarded in defamation of character lawsuits are not limited to the potential or actual financial damages cause. The complainant can be awarded punitive damages, essentially designed to punish the defendant for defaming the complainant. The complainant can also be awarded damages as a means of compesation for the damage to their reputation, embarrassment they may feel, pain caused etc. by the defamation.
